3.7 Selection of GPS Antenna Mount Location
Before selecting the GPS antenna location, the following items must be considered:
•
Preferred location
. The preferred GPS antenna location is the top of the cab or roof
structure with the ability to look upward.
•
Flat surface mount
. The GPS antenna should be mounted on a flat horizontal
surface with no metallic overhead obstacles.
•
Mount near FM/DHF antenna
. If possible, mount the GPS antenna near the
FM/DHF antenna so that the antenna cables can share a common route to the ITU.
•
Air dam.
The GPS antenna can be mounted under the roof-mounted air dam if the
air dam is constructed of either fiberglass or other non-metallic composite material.
•
Cable length.
Upon determination of a suitable mounting location, verify that there
will be an adequate length of cable to reach the ITU. The GPS antenna is packaged
with a pre-configured length of cable and may not be modified.
3.8 Selection of Driver Terminal (DT) Location
The DT location must be far enough away from the driver so that the driver cannot attempt to
drive and use the DT at the same time; yet, it must remain within easy access. Proximity to
the driver, cable length from the DT to the ITU, and sturdiness of the desired DT cradle
attachment points are all important considerations.
Typical locations are on the passenger side dash, behind either seat, on a closet, or on a bunk
wall. On day cabs, locate the DT between seats or on the back wall. Select a location where
the DT will not be subjected to direct sunlight. Avoid placing the DT on top of the dash or in
rear seat windows. The customer should also be consulted when choosing a DT location.
